Thursday our commission heard a presentation for the installation of Red Light Cameras at both intersections in High Springs. The ordinance had already been passed back in 2009 to declare the City’s need for such systems, but due to pending legal claims in other cities and an uncertain future for legislation pending the State House [...]

Tonight we had the opportunity to select a commissioner to fill the seat vacated by former Vice-Mayor Diane Shupe.
With 10 well qualified applicants, the night was filled with plenty of votes and failed motions! Through a process of nominations and voting, the field was eliminated down to three applicants. All three failed with a [...]
